Goodyear has been recognized as one of America’s most reputable companies by Forbes magazine.
The tiremaker ranked 40th on Forbes’ fifth annual listing of companies with the best reputations in the U.S. It was the highest ranking for any automotive firm, and Goodyear was the only tiremaker to make the list.
The results come from the Reputation Institute’s U.S. Reputation Pulse consumer opinion survey, which measures the overall respect, trust, esteem, admiration and good feelings consumers hold toward the country’s 150 largest companies.
Goodyear’s score of 74.24, represented a 0.79 point increase over 2009.
